I'm working on a model of the Soviet N1. I found the pattern for a paper model online. I've blown it up 201% and spray glued the xeroxed patterns onto various card stocks and "bristol board" stock. I built up the rocket around a standard body tube. It's coming along nicely, and it's time for me to start thinking about the CG and the CP.
The N1's shape was essentially one huge cone (with no fins). My model is a 57 inch tall cone, that has a base diameter of 9 inches. At present it weighs a little over 1 pound. I've used the swing test on rockets this size before to test for stability, but I was wondering if any of you guys with Rocksim or some other such software could punch in the above data and tell me where aproximately I should find my CG? I'm ready to start adding weight to the nose, but I don't want to add any more than necessary.
